Conclusion Meanings:

'Exonerated': or 'Within NYPD Guidelines' - The conduct occurred but did not violate the NYPD's own rules, which often give officers significant discretion.
'Substantiated': The misconduct occurred and it violated the rules. The NYPD has discretion over what, if any, discipline is imposed.
'Unable to Determine': The alleged conduct was investigated but could not determine both that the conduct occurred and that it broke the rules.
'Unsubstantiated': or 'Unable to Determine' - The alleged conduct was investigated but could not determine both that the conduct occurred and that it broke the rules.

Lawsuits

Named in 2 known lawsuits, $165,000 total settlements.

Dickerson, Terrence vs City of New York, et al.
Case # 523121/2020, Supreme Court - Kings, November 24, 2020, ended December 18, 2024
$125,000 Settlement
Complaint
Description: On June 5, 2020, at approximately 8:30 p.m., Terrence Dickerson was in the vicinity of 740 Eldert Lane in Brooklyn, New York, when he was allegedly assaulted, battered, and falsely arrested by police officers Tyler Angelo and Alec Solomito, both acting as part of their duties with the NYPD. The officers allegedly used excessive force, wrongfully detained, and imprisoned Dickerson without probable cause. He was charged with several offenses, including obstructing governmental administration, resisting arrest, and criminal possession of a weapon, despite his claims of innocence.
